Basingstoke pensioner charged garage rent for 53 weeks this year

A BASINGSTOKE pensioner has been left fuming after a housing association said that it will charge him rent for 53 weeks this year.
Ken Holland, 67, pays a weekly rent of £19.40 for two blue Sovereign housing association garages in Gainsborough Road, and neighbouring Landseer Road in Black Dam.
He said that “as a point of principle” he will not pay for the 53rd week and called the bill unfair.
In a statement, Sovereign said that Mr Holland’s contract requires him to pay every Monday – and in the 2013-14 financial year there are 53 Mondays.
“Mr Holland is charged a weekly rent on his garages,” Sovereign said in a statement.
“Once every five or six years, there are 53 Mondays in a year.
“In most years, we only charge rent for 364 days a year, and this additional week accounts for the days that he has not been charged in the previous years.”
However, speaking to The Gazette, Mr Holland, a retired lorry driver, who lives in Grove Road, said: “As far as I am concerned I am going to pay them for 52 weeks. It is a point of principle for me.
“If it was a house, that say was £150 per week, some people would struggle to pay it. It is not a question of the money. It is a question of the principle.”
The father-of-four added: “When I lived in Gainsborough Road with young children it was a struggle.
“It was tough bringing up a new a young family and to spring something that you have not budgeted for is just stupid.”
